Awareness, Discernment and Neuroplasticity
Our brains are constantly taking in information from both inside the body and the world around us. Much of this happens outside of conscious awareness. Sensations, sounds, facial expressions, memories, emotions, and changes in our environment are continually being processed, while the brain uses previous experience to help determine what deserves our attention.
Awareness allows us to notice more of what is already happening. When we bring conscious attention to a sensation or experience, we aren't necessarily changing it—we are simply including it in our perception of the present moment. We might notice tension in the shoulders, the rhythm of our breathing, the warmth of sunlight on our skin, the strength in our legs, or the feeling of ease that arises when we are with someone we trust. The more curious our awareness becomes, the more information we have available to us.
This is where discernment enters. Rather than automatically accepting the loudest sensation or thought as the whole truth of the moment, we can become curious about what our body and environment are actually telling us. Is this tension alerting me to something happening now, or might an older experience be influencing how I interpret this moment? Is there something here that truly needs my attention? What feels supportive? What feels nourishing? And perhaps most importantly: what else is true right now?
When we have experienced prolonged stress, pain, loss, or trauma, the brain may become especially practiced at recognizing signals associated with difficulty or threat. This is part of the brain's protective nature. Previous experiences help the brain anticipate what might happen next. Sometimes, however, an old pattern can become so familiar that it continues to influence our perception even when our circumstances have changed.
Fortunately, the brain remains capable of change. Neuroplasticity describes the brain's ability to strengthen, weaken, and reorganize neural connections in response to experience. Patterns that are repeatedly activated can become increasingly familiar and efficient. This is how we learn skills and habits, and it is also part of how emotional and protective patterns become established. Importantly, neuroplasticity continues throughout our lives. The brain that learned from difficult experiences can also learn from experiences of safety, pleasure, connection, strength, beauty, and joy.
This doesn't mean ignoring discomfort. Perhaps my feet hurt as I hike, and my legs feel strong. My neck is tight, and the warmth of the sun on my face feels wonderful. I feel anxious about tomorrow, and right now I am sitting somewhere I feel safe. Awareness allows me to notice both. Discernment helps me understand what each experience may be telling me.
And pleasure is information, too. A spontaneous deeper breath, warmth in the chest, laughter, curiosity, the pleasure of movement, the scent of the forest, or the feeling of being at ease with another person all provide information to the brain. When we pause long enough to become aware of these experiences, we give the brain an opportunity to learn from them rather than allowing them to disappear unnoticed into the background.
We aren't trying to convince ourselves that everything is good or replace difficult experiences with positive thinking. We are widening the field of awareness and allowing the brain to receive more complete information about the present. With repetition, new experiences can contribute to new neural learning and may begin to change some of the patterns through which we interpret ourselves and the world around us.
Perhaps healing involves becoming more aware of what is already here, more discerning about what our experiences are telling us, and more intentional about what we allow ourselves to fully experience.
Our brains learned from what hurt. They can learn from what feels good, too.
